Examples of feminism include advocating for equal pay for equal work, fighting against gender-based violence, and promoting reproductive rights and health care. Activities like organizing women’s marches, campaigning for political representation, and educating about gender equality in schools and workplaces are also prevalent forms of feminist action. At its core, feminism seeks to address inequalities and strive for equal rights and opportunities for all genders, illustrating a broad spectrum of advocacy from grassroots activism to global movements.
